This medical animation demonstrates the mechanism of action (MOA) of Evenity (romosozumab), a novel bone forming agent that inhibits the protein sclerostin to promote gains in bone mass. We created an isolated bone cube and visually distinct cell groups to clearly illustrate the complementary processes of bone formation and bone resorption in osteoporosis and its treatment.
